Downtown Loft with Skylights
In this late work (made with Azazel Jacobs’s participation), Ken Jacobs returns to an earlier (and frequent) subject, the bric-a-brac-laden loft in which he and Flo lived, and from it he derives a lacunar, fragmented, sculptural reenvisioning of on-screen (and domestic) space. Made in 2024, world premiere at Film at Lincoln Center on April 20, 2026.

🎬 MovieFinder's Take
Jacobs constructs the film as a tactile archive, relying on the materiality of the loft space to turn it into an optical instrument for examining time. He employs fragmentation to dismantle conventional perspective into its components, guiding the eye through gaps and accumulations.
What lingers after viewing is a resonant sense of domestic space transformed into pure sculpture, where the familiar dissolves into abstract, lingering patterns. — MovieFinder Editorial
